WA’s cultural diversity on the runway

Diversity will shine at this year’s Telstra Perth Fashion Festival with the introduction of The Language of Fashion: Multicultural Runway, featuring models and clothing honouring the breadth of cultures in Western Australia.

The new addition to the festival is part a suite of free events being held at Fashion Centre in Forrest Place and is supported by the McGowan Government via the Office of Multicultural Interests’ Community Grants Program.

Fashion Council WA have worked closely with community groups to develop the event, which will showcase a number of African, Indian and modest dress collections.

The event aims to provide a platform for culturally diverse groups at one of the State’s most popular festivals as well as further highlight WA’s dynamic fashion sector to the vibrant cultures right on their doorstep.

The Language of Fashion: Multicultural Runway is on Saturday, September 9 from 3pm at Forrest Place. For more information, visit http://www.omi.wa.gov.au
